1. Real-Time GPS Tracking and Geo-Intelligence
One of the foundational features every delivery app must have is real-time GPS tracking. This allows customers and dispatchers to monitor the precise location of deliveries at any moment. Geo-intelligent delivery slot scheduling, which leverages geographic data, further optimizes routes and delivery windows to minimize delays and reduce fuel costs. For construction suppliers, this ensures critical materials arrive exactly when needed, preventing costly project delays.

2. Mobile-First User Interface
With delivery drivers often working remotely and on the move, a mobile-first design is imperative. A delivery app with a responsive and intuitive mobile interface improves communication within fleet teams, enabling quick updates, proof of delivery capture, and navigation assistance. Mobile-first interfaces also facilitate real-time push notifications to customers, enhancing transparency and trust.

3. Seamless ERP Integration
To streamline operations, a delivery app should seamlessly integrate with ERP systems like Buildix ERP. This integration ensures synchronization of inventory levels, order statuses, and customer data between the ERP and delivery platform. Automated workflows reduce manual entry errors, improve order accuracy, and allow for real-time status updates, which are crucial for managing complex building material deliveries.

4. AI-Powered Demand Forecasting and Scaling
Seasonal demand fluctuations, common in construction and building supplies, require delivery apps that can scale efficiently. AI-driven predictive analytics help forecast delivery volumes and optimize fleet allocation during peak periods. This technology enables companies to maintain high service levels without over-investing in resources, reducing both operational costs and delivery delays.

5. Customizable KPI Dashboards for Last-Mile Teams
Measuring delivery performance is vital for continuous improvement. Delivery apps should provide customizable KPI dashboards tailored to last-mile teams, highlighting metrics such as delivery times, success rates, and customer feedback scores. These insights empower logistics managers to pinpoint inefficiencies and develop targeted improvements, enhancing both operational effectiveness and customer satisfaction.

6. Contactless Proof of Delivery
In today’s health-conscious environment, contactless proof of delivery (POD) has become a critical feature. Delivery apps should enable digital signatures, photo capture, and barcode scanning without physical contact, ensuring safety for drivers and customers alike. For businesses handling bulky building materials, this feature expedites delivery confirmation while maintaining operational hygiene standards.

7. Flexible Payment and Billing Integration
A delivery app that supports flexible payment options and integrates billing seamlessly with ERP accounting modules simplifies financial reconciliation. Whether handling prepaid orders, COD (cash on delivery), or credit terms, the app should provide secure transaction processing and detailed invoicing. This flexibility improves cash flow management and enhances customer convenience.
